隨著在線游戲的普及和用戶需求的不斷提高,游戲服務(wù)器在處理大規(guī)模游戲世界方面面臨著巨大的挑戰(zhàn)。本文將介紹美國游戲服務(wù)器如何處理大規(guī)模游戲世界的實(shí)現(xiàn),包括分布式架構(gòu)、云計算技術(shù)、虛擬化技術(shù)等方面。同時,還將探討一些優(yōu)化策略,以提高游戲服務(wù)器的性能和穩(wěn)定性,為玩家提供更好的游戲體驗(yàn)。
分布式架構(gòu)
分布式架構(gòu)是處理大規(guī)模游戲世界的常用技術(shù)之一。通過將游戲服務(wù)器分布在多個物理位置上,可以減少單個服務(wù)器的負(fù)載和壓力,提高系統(tǒng)的可靠性和容錯性。另外,分布式架構(gòu)還可以實(shí)現(xiàn)地域分布,即將服務(wù)器部署在離玩家較近的地方,降低延遲和網(wǎng)絡(luò)傳輸帶寬,提高響應(yīng)速度和游戲體驗(yàn)。
云計算技術(shù)
云計算技術(shù)是當(dāng)前處理大規(guī)模游戲世界的趨勢和發(fā)展方向。通過使用云計算平臺提供的強(qiáng)大計算資源和存儲能力,游戲服務(wù)器可以更好地處理海量數(shù)據(jù)和用戶請求。同時,云計算還可以實(shí)現(xiàn)彈性伸縮,即根據(jù)實(shí)際負(fù)載情況自動調(diào)整計算和存儲資源,避免浪費(fèi)和不必要的成本。
虛擬化技術(shù)
虛擬化技術(shù)是將物理資源劃分為多個虛擬資源的一種技術(shù)。在游戲服務(wù)器中,虛擬化技術(shù)可以實(shí)現(xiàn)虛擬服務(wù)器,即將單個物理服務(wù)器劃分為多個虛擬服務(wù)器,以提高資源利用率和靈活性。另外,虛擬化技術(shù)還可以實(shí)現(xiàn)容器化部署,即將游戲服務(wù)器應(yīng)用程序和依賴項打包為容器,并在多個物理服務(wù)器上部署和運(yùn)行,實(shí)現(xiàn)更高的可擴(kuò)展性和彈性。
優(yōu)化策略
除了上述技術(shù),游戲服務(wù)器還可以通過一些優(yōu)化策略來提高性能和穩(wěn)定性。例如,可以使用緩存技術(shù)和負(fù)載均衡技術(shù)來減少網(wǎng)絡(luò)傳輸和服務(wù)器負(fù)載,提高響應(yīng)速度。另外,還可以實(shí)現(xiàn)數(shù)據(jù)壓縮和去重技術(shù),以減少數(shù)據(jù)傳輸和存儲空間,提高效率和節(jié)省成本。
結(jié)論:
綜上所述,美國游戲服務(wù)器在處理大規(guī)模游戲世界方面采用了一系列先進(jìn)的技術(shù)和優(yōu)化策略,包括分布式架構(gòu)、云計算技術(shù)、虛擬化技術(shù)等方面。這些技術(shù)和策略的應(yīng)用為玩家提供了更好的游戲體驗(yàn)和服務(wù),同時也推動了游戲服務(wù)器的發(fā)展和進(jìn)步。